Install Across Your Company
Capturing bill of materials Autodesk DWF Viewer can be installed
silently via the following:
msiexec /i SetupDWFViewer.msi /qn
Review & Mark Up

Your IT department can install the


Autodesk DWF Viewer across your com- 1. Embed DWF files directly in web pages
pany. By installing the Autodesk DWF by using the <object> element tag.
Viewer silently, the viewer can be includ-
ed as part of a company-wide automated
